Artie Isaac co-founded SpeakerSite, an online community of public speakers and event planners (2008), and Young Isaac, an award-winning creative marketing strategy and advertising agency (1990). A sought-after teacher and public speaker, he teaches Strategy, Creativity, and Ethics in Marketing at CCAD and Personal Creativity and Innovation at Ohio State University’s Fisher College of Business. Isaac started his career with agencies in New York, including Ogilvy & Mather. He holds an M.B.A. in Marketing from Columbia, a B.A. in English Literature from Yale, and a high school diploma—and varsity letter for cheerleading—from the Columbus Academy.
